site stats

How does pipelining improve performance

WebDec 15, 2024 · Achieving peak performance requires an efficient input pipeline that delivers data for the next step before the current step has finished. The tf.data API helps to build flexible and efficient input pipelines. This document demonstrates how to use the tf.data API to build highly performant TensorFlow input pipelines. WebJan 1, 2005 · Super pipelining improves the performance by decomposing the long latency stages (such as memory access stages) of a pipeline into several shorter stages, thereby …

Answered: How does pipelining improve the… bartleby

WebAug 3, 2024 · How does pipeline improve performance? Pipelining is a technique used to improve the execution throughput of a CPU by using the processor resources in a more … WebApr 12, 2024 · Deployment frequency and lead time are important because they reflect the quality and speed of your software delivery pipeline. A high deployment frequency means that you can release new features ... sharepoint lookup list filter https://lutzlandsurveying.com

How does pipelining improve performance? – WittyQuestion.com

WebJan 2, 2024 · The first step is to fetch the instruction from memory into the CPU to begin execution. In the second step, the instruction is decoded so the CPU can figure out what type of instruction it is ... WebPipelining typically reduces the processor's cycle time and increases the throughput of instructions. The speed advantage is diminished to the extent that execution encounters … WebSep 10, 2024 · A well-managed sales pipeline enables you to evaluate and optimize your process at every stage, assuring you increased revenue at the end of a sales cycle. As … sharepoint lookup from another site

Computer Organization and Architecture Pipelining Set …

Category:Pipelining - Stanford University

Tags:How does pipelining improve performance

How does pipelining improve performance

What is pipelining how it is achieved in 8086 microprocessor?

WebHow the pipeline architecture improves the performance of the computer system? Pipelining : Pipelining is a process of arrangement of hardware elements of the CPU such … WebJun 28, 2024 · Pipeline performance can be optimized through algorithmic optimization, parallelization and pipelining. Algorithmic optimization is the first priority, as it is purely a …

How does pipelining improve performance

Did you know?

WebThe main advantage of the pipelining process is, it can increase the performance of the throughput, it needs modern processors and compilation Techniques. The pipelining concept uses circuit Technology. It Circuit Technology, builds the … WebOct 19, 2024 · How Pipelining improves CPU Performance? In general, CPU can break an instruction in the following 4 subtasks(at a very basic level): Fetch– fetching the instruction from memory. Decode–...

WebEngineering Computer Science How does pipelining improve the performance of a processor? How does pipelining improve the performance of a processor? Question Transcribed Image Text: Q4 (a) How does pipelining improve the performance of a processor? (b) Figure Q4 shows a sequence of Intel x86 assembly language. WebAnswer: Pipelining increases the CPU instruction throughput – the number of instructions completed per unit of time. But it does not reduce the execution time of an individual instruction. In fact, it usually slightly increases the execution time of each instruction due to overhead in the pipeline control. What is efficiency in pipelining?

WebJan 18, 2024 · How does pipelining improve computational performance? Pipelining doesn’t improve computational performance it just reduces the impact of memory latency on the ability to issue instructions. Of course, memory latency can degrade computational performance and it is the most common bottleneck in modern architectures. WebPIpelining, a standard feature in RISC processors, is much like an assembly line. Because the processor works on different steps of the instruction at the same time, more instructions can be executed in a shorter period of time. …

WebJul 30, 2024 · In computer networking, pipelining is the method of sending multiple data units without waiting for an acknowledgment for the first frame sent. Pipelining ensures better utilization of network resources and also increases the speed of delivery, particularly in situations where a large number of data units make up a message to be sent.

WebPerformance Metrics 4. Summarizing Performance, Amdahl’s law and Benchmarks ... Observe that the speedup is due to increased throughput and the latency (time for each instruction) does not decrease. The basic features of pipelining are: • Pipelining does not help latency of single task, it only helps throughput of entire workload ... sharepoint lookup person or groupWebThe main advantage of pipelining is that it allows a greater instruction throughput by allowing different parts of multiple instructions to be overlapped in execution. see Figure 6.2: Total time for eight instructions calculated from the time for each component. Let's assume these times for these instructions. sharepoint lookup people columnWebNov 3, 2024 · Pipelining increases the performance of the system with simple design changes in the hardware. It facilitates parallelism in execution at the hardware level. … sharepoint lowood state high schoolWebDoes pipelining always increase performance? Pipelining increases the CPU instruction throughput - the number of instructions completed per unit of time. But it does not reduce the execution time of an individual instruction. In fact, it usually slightly increases the execution time of each instruction due to overhead in the pipeline control. sharepoint loopback checkWeb1 day ago · ExxonMobil handed its chief executive a 52% pay increase to $35.9m (£28.7m) for 2024 after the oil company reported its highest ever profits amid Russia’s invasion of Ukraine. Darren Woods ... sharepoint lookup field from another listWebJan 1, 2005 · Super pipelining improves the performance by decomposing the long latency stages (such as memory access stages) of a pipeline into several shorter stages, thereby possibly increasing the number of instructions running in parallel at each cycle. popcorn diabetes goodWebSep 2, 2024 · How does pipeline improve performance? Super pipelining improves the performance by decomposing the long latency stages (such as memory access stages) of a pipeline into several shorter stages, thereby possibly increasing the number of instructions running in parallel at each cycle. How pipeline can increase the performance? sharepoint lookup with picker